Najczęstsze objawy awarii WordPressa
WordPress może przestać działać na kilka sposobów. Czasem nie ładuje się cała strona, czasem tylko panel administracyjny, a czasem problem dotyczy pojedynczego formularza, sklepu WooCommerce albo konkretnej podstrony.
- biały ekran zamiast strony,
- komunikat „W witrynie wystąpił błąd krytyczny”,
- błąd 500, 403, 404 albo problem z przekierowaniami,
- brak dostępu do panelu
/wp-admin, - niedziałające formularze, koszyk WooCommerce albo płatności,
- problemy po aktualizacji wtyczki, motywu lub wersji PHP.
Pierwsze kroki diagnostyczne
Sprawdź, czy działa panel hostingu, czy domena wskazuje na właściwy serwer i czy certyfikat SSL jest aktywny. Następnie zweryfikuj, czy hosting nie osiągnął limitu miejsca, pamięci RAM, CPU albo liczby procesów PHP.
Jeżeli masz dostęp do plików, zajrzyj do logów błędów. Często dokładny komunikat wskazuje konkretną wtyczkę, motyw lub funkcję PHP powodującą awarię.
Awaria po aktualizacji WordPressa lub wtyczki
To jeden z najczęstszych scenariuszy. Nowa wersja wtyczki może być niezgodna z motywem, wersją PHP albo innym rozszerzeniem. W takiej sytuacji nie zawsze najlepszym wyjściem jest przywrócenie całej strony z backupu. Czasem wystarczy wyłączyć problematyczną wtyczkę, cofnąć konkretną aktualizację albo poprawić błąd w kodzie.
Błąd 500, biały ekran i błąd krytyczny
Te błędy zwykle oznaczają problem po stronie PHP, pamięci, konfliktu wtyczek albo uszkodzonego pliku. Warto włączyć tryb debugowania tylko na czas diagnostyki i nie zostawiać publicznie widocznych komunikatów błędów, bo mogą ujawniać ścieżki plików i szczegóły konfiguracji.
WordPress przestał działać?
Możemy sprawdzić logi, wtyczki, motyw, wersję PHP, bazę danych i hosting. Przywrócimy działanie strony bez zgadywania.
Jak zabezpieczyć stronę przed kolejną awarią
Regularny backup przed aktualizacjami, testowanie większych zmian poza produkcją, aktualna wersja PHP i stały monitoring znacząco ograniczają ryzyko awarii. Przy stronie firmowej warto mieć osobę techniczną, która zna środowisko i może zareagować, zanim problem przełoży się na utracone zapytania.
